>The Aztecs believed that when an Aztec noble would die, it was necessary to slay a Chihuahua and bury or cremate it with the body of the human. They believed that the spirit of the dead Chihuahua would act as a guide through the afterlife for the soul of the dead noble. The human spirit needed help swimming across a river into the afterlife and would crawl onto the back of the Chihuahua spirit to reach his heavenly destination in the afterlife. There is evidence that the nobility kept large packs of hundreds of dogs.
